The Garmin fēnix 8 is a robust multisport GPS smartwatch designed for athletes and outdoor enthusiasts who need reliable performance and durability. Its 1.4-inch AMOLED display offers bright, sharp visuals protected by a scratch-resistant sapphire lens, making it easy to read in various lighting conditions. The titanium bezel and pebble gray band add to its premium and rugged feel.
Battery life is impressive, lasting up to 29 days in smartwatch mode and 84 hours with continuous GPS use, so it easily supports long adventures without frequent charging. GPS accuracy is enhanced by multi-band GPS with SatIQ technology and built-in sensors, ensuring precise location tracking and turn-by-turn navigation for varied workouts or outdoor exploration. The watch provides comprehensive health monitoring, including wrist-based heart rate tracking, advanced sleep analysis, respiration tracking, and Pulse Ox measurements. It also offers an ECG app to check heart rhythm for atrial fibrillation.
With a 40-meter dive rating and leakproof metal buttons, it supports scuba and apnea diving, reinforcing its water resistance and durability. Smart features include making and taking calls directly from the wrist, voice assistant integration, and offline voice commands, adding convenience for daily use. This smartwatch is well suited for active users who want a high-end, durable device with excellent battery life, reliable GPS, and extensive fitness tracking capabilities.

The Garmin fēnix 8 Pro is a high-end multisport GPS smartwatch designed for users seeking premium performance and rugged reliability. It features a bright 1.4-inch AMOLED touchscreen protected by a scratch-resistant sapphire lens, delivering sharp and easily readable display quality in various lighting conditions. Its titanium bezel adds durability while keeping the watch lightweight and comfortable for extended wear.
Battery life is robust for a feature-rich device, supported by a 759mAh lithium-ion cell, though intensive use of GPS and satellite communication may reduce it. The built-in GPS is highly accurate and enhanced by preloaded TopoActive maps and navigation tools, making it ideal for activities like hiking, skiing, and golf. Comprehensive health monitoring includes wrist-based heart rate tracking, sleep analysis, HRV, ECG app, and a Pulse Ox sensor, offering detailed wellness insights without serving as a medical device.
Water resistance rated to 40 meters supports swimming and scuba diving, with leakproof metal buttons to prevent moisture ingress. A standout feature is the inReach satellite technology, providing two-way messaging and SOS functions even when off the grid, which requires an active subscription but can be lifesaving during remote adventures. Smart features include LTE calls and messaging, music playback, and tracking sharing without needing a nearby phone. The watch is somewhat larger and heavier, which may not appeal to those preferring minimalist wearables, and its premium materials and advanced technology come with a higher price point. It is best suited for serious athletes, outdoor adventurers, and anyone needing robust navigation, safety, and detailed health tracking.

The Garmin Instinct 3 is a rugged outdoor GPS smartwatch designed for adventure seekers and those who spend a lot of time outdoors. Its standout feature is the solar-charged display, which can provide virtually unlimited battery life in smartwatch mode if you spend enough time outside daily. This means less worry about frequent charging, which is great for long trips. The 1.1-inch round display is clear and durable, protected by a metal-reinforced bezel and a tough fiber-reinforced polymer case built to military standards for shock and thermal resistance.
GPS accuracy is enhanced with multi-band GPS and SatIQ technology, ensuring reliable tracking and efficient battery use, which benefits hikers, runners, and others who rely on precise location data. Heart rate monitoring and health tracking, including Pulse Ox and advanced sleep analysis, offer good insights into your body's status, though it's important to remember these aren’t medical-grade measurements. Water resistance up to 10 ATM allows for swimming and water-based activities without worry.
The watch also includes handy smart features like Garmin Pay for contactless payments, smart notifications, and safety tools that can send your location to emergency contacts if needed, which is helpful for outdoor safety. The modest 1.1-inch display size might be small for users who prefer bigger screens or more detailed visuals. While the solar charging extends battery life impressively outdoors, indoor usage will require more frequent charging. Some advanced features like Pulse Ox might not work in all countries. This watch excels in durability, battery life, and outdoor navigation features, making it a solid choice for outdoor enthusiasts who want a reliable, tough smartwatch with helpful smart capabilities.
